Is it considered a sin for a fasting woman to inform her non-Muslim colleagues at work about the arrival of the iftar meal?

1 min readAlso available in العربية

It is not permissible for a Muslim to help someone who is breaking their fast during the day in Ramadan—whether Muslim or non-Muslim—with food and drink if their breaking of the fast is without a valid excuse. This is because it constitutes cooperation in sin and transgression. Scholars have explicitly stated the prohibition of providing drink to a Dhimmī during the day in Ramadan.
